Farmers to protest at meat factories

FARMERS are to hold overnight cattle price protests next Sunday evening and Monday outside the six meat factories owned by the country’s largest beef processor, the AIBP group.

The plants are located in Nenagh, Cahir, Bandon, Waterford, Rathkeale and Clones.

IFA president John Dillon said the final straw for farmers was this week’s latest price cut by the factories in the week that the Russian market was re-opened for all counties.
